zmq_has(3)
|
||||||
|
==========
|
||||||
|
|
||||||
|
|
||||||
|
NAME
|
||||||
|
----
|
||||||
|
zmq_has - check a ZMQ capability
|
||||||
|
|
||||||
|
|
||||||
|
SYNOPSIS
|
||||||
|
--------
|
||||||
|
*int zmq_has (const char *capability);*
|
||||||
|
|
||||||
|
|
||||||
|
DESCRIPTION
|
||||||
|
-----------
|
||||||
|
The _zmq_has()_ function shall report whether a specified capability is
|
||||||
|
available in the library. This allows bindings and applications to probe
|
||||||
|
a library directly, for transport and security options.
|
||||||
|
|
||||||
|
Capabilities shall be lowercase strings. The following capabilities are
|
||||||
|
defined:
|
||||||
|
|
||||||
|
* ipc - the library supports the ipc:// protocol
|
||||||
|
* pgm - the library supports the pgm:// protocol
|
||||||
|
* tipc - the library supports the tipc:// protocol
|
||||||
|
* norm - the library supports the norm:// protocol
|
||||||
|
* curve - the library supports the CURVE security mechanism
|
||||||
|
* gssapi - the library supports the GSSAPI security mechanism
|
||||||
|
|
||||||
|
When this method is provided, the zmq.h header file will define
|
||||||
|
ZMQ_HAS_CAPABILITIES.
|
||||||
|
|
||||||
|
RETURN VALUE
|
||||||
|
------------
|
||||||
|
The _zmq_has()_ function shall return 1 if the specified capability is
|
||||||
|
provided. Otherwise it shall return 0.
